Hannah Joyce DUKE [154]

  • Born: 9 May 1916, Blyth, South Australia
  • Marriage (1): Albert Ronald GOODENOUGH [409] on 17 May 1941 in Spicer Memorial Church, St Peters, Adelaide
  • Marriage (2): Colin Arthur HUGHES [235] on 20 Sep 1948 in Methodist Church, Archer St, North Adelaide, South Australia
  • Died: 22 Dec 2006, Nursing Home, Elizabeth, South Australia at age 90
  • Buried: 28 Dec 2006, Enfield Memorial Park, Clearview, Adelaide, South Australia

Joyce married Albert Ronald GOODENOUGH [409] [MRIN: 138], son of William George GOODENOUGH [5658] and Ada Elizabeth RANDELL [5659], on 17 May 1941 in Spicer Memorial Church, St Peters, Adelaide. (Albert Ronald GOODENOUGH [409] was born on 25 Sep 1915 in St Peters, Adelaide, South Australia, died on 8 Mar 1947 in Magill, Adelaide, South Australia and was buried on 9 Mar 1947 in Enfield Memorial Park, Clearview, Adelaide, South Australia.)


bullet  Marriage Notes:


Chronicle (Adelaide, SA : 1895 - 1954) Thu 27 May 1937 Page 25
Engagement:
DUKE \emdash GOODENOUGH.\emdash The engagement is announced of Joyce, only daughter of Mr. and Mrs. E. G. Duke, late of Blyth, to Albert (Mick), fourth son of Mr. and Mrs. W. G. Goodenough, of St. Peters.


The Advertiser (Adelaide) Saturday 10 May 1941
Approaching Marriage Notice:
DUKE-GOODENOUGH. -The marriage of Joyce, only daughter of Mr. and Mrs. E. G. Duke, West Coast, to Albert, fourth son of Mr. and Mrs. W. Goodenough, of St. Peters, will be solemnised at Spicer Memorial Church, Fourth avenue, St. Peters, on Saturday, the 17th of May, at 7 p.m.
